Washington Regional Medical System is seeking a Sterile Processing Technician to perform decontamination and sterilization of hospital instruments, reporting to the Sterile Processing Department Manager. The role requires ensuring proper sterilization techniques and maintaining instrument readiness for procedures.

Washington Regional Medical System is a community-owned, locally governed, non-profit health care system located in Northwest Arkansas in the heart of Fayetteville, which is consistently ranked among the Best Places to live in the country. Our 425-bed medical center has been named the #1 hospital in Arkansas for five consecutive years by U.S. News & World Report. We employ 3,200+ team members and serve the region with over 40 clinic locations, the region’s only Level II trauma center, and five Centers of Excellence - the Washington Regional J.B. Hunt Transport Services Neuroscience Institute; Washington Regional Walker Heart Institute; Washington Regional Women and Infants Center; Washington Regional Total Joint Center; and Washington Regional Pat Walker Center for Seniors.
The role of the Sterile Processing Technician reports to the Sterile Processing Department Manager. This position is responsible for the decontamination and sterilization of all hospital instruments.
This position will spend 100% of the time standing and/or walking short distances with frequent pushing, pulling, and/or lifting up to 50lbs. This position will be exposed to body fluids and communicable diseases.
